Snoop Dogg has released his latest single and music video, “Stop Counting My Poccets,” inspired by classic West Coast gangster films.
The video marks the first visual from his upcoming album, 10 Til’ Midnight, scheduled for release on April 10.
Cinematic Music Video Concept
Directed by Luis De Pena and Yaslynn Rivera, the video is primarily shot in black and white.
It features appearances from West Coast artistes including:
- Ray Vaughn
- G Perico
- Hitta J3
- BLK ODYSSY
The storyline follows two brothers, Ru Little and Do Wrong, both portrayed by Snoop Dogg, focusing on tension and the consequences of their decisions.
Star-Studded Album Collaborations
The album “10 Til’ Midnight” will feature collaborations with:
- Swizz Beatz
- Peezy
- Trinidad James
- October London
- Kanobby
- Shawn Louisiana
Production credits include:
- Pharrell Williams
- Rick Rock
- Soopafly
- Nottz
- MyGuyMars
- Erick Sermon
- YoungFyre
- Alongside Snoop Dogg himself
Snoop on the Creative Vision
Speaking on the project, Snoop Dogg said:
“We wanted to bring the story to life, showing the choices and challenges these characters face. The visuals are a part of the album’s world, giving fans more than just the music.”
Upcoming Film Project
Snoop Dogg is also preparing to star in and produce the soundtrack for the upcoming film God of the Rodeo, a true-crime thriller directed by Rosalind.
